LOAN AGREEMENT

THIS LOAN AGREEMENT is made and entered into by and between the Lender and the Borrower, under the circumstances summarized in the following recitals (the capitalized terms used in the recitals being used therein as defined in Article I hereof):

WHEREAS, pursuant to the Act, the Director of Development of the State of Ohio (the “Director”) is authorized, among other things, to make loans to assist in acquiring constructing, reconstructing, rehabilitating, renovating, enlarging, improving, equipping, or furnishing buildings, structures, improvements and equipment and other property for industry, commerce, distribution or research in the State of Ohio; and

WHEREAS, by the Escrow Agreement the Director has made funds available to the Lender for the purpose of providing assistance to borrowers to pay a portion of the Allowable Costs of Projects under the Demonstration Program and the Act; and

WHEREAS, the Borrower has requested that the Lender provide the financial assistance under the Demonstration Program for the Project hereinafter described; and

WHEREAS, the Director has determined that the Project constitutes an eligible project within the meaning of the Act and that the financial assistance to be provided pursuant to this Loan Agreement is appropriate under the Demonstration Program and the Act and will be in furtherance of and in implementation of the public policy set forth in the Act; and

WHEREAS, the financial assistance to be provided pursuant to this Loan Agreement has been recommended by the Development Financing Advisory Board and approved by the Controlling Board pursuant to the Act;

NOW THEREFORE, in consideration of the mutual promises and the representations and agreements hereinafter contained, the Lender and the Borrower agree as follows:

ARTICLE I

DEFINITIONS

Section 1.1.      Use of Defined Terms.  In addition to the words and terms elsewhere defined in this Loan Agreement or by reference to the Security Documents or other instruments, the words and terms set forth in Section 1.2 hereof shall have the meanings therein set forth unless the context or use expressly indicates a different meaning or intent.  Such definitions shall be equally applicable to both the singular and plural forms of any of the words and terms therein defined.

Section 1.2.      Definitions.   As used herein:

“Act” means Chapter 166, Ohio Revised Code, as from time to time enacted and amended.

“Adverse Market Conditions” means such economic conditions as shall have been determined by the Director, with the advice of the Federal Reserve Bank of Cleveland, including but not limited to the following consideration:  (a) two (2) consecutive quarters of decline in the Federal Reserve Bank of Cleveland’s Ohio Manufacturing Index, whether as a whole or by relevant manufacturing section;   (b) at least twelve (12) of thirty-six (36) months of decline in the Federal Reserve Bank of Cleveland’s National Industrial Index, whether as a whole, or by relevant manufacturing sector; or  (c ) decline within the relevant manufacturing sector, as announced by Standard and Poor’s Industrial Outlook.

ARTICLE III

THE LOAN;  THE PROJECT;  DISBURSEMENT

Section 3.1.    Loan and Repayment.       On the terms and conditions of this Loan Agreement, the Lender shall lend to the Borrower the Loan Amount to assist in the financing of the Allowable Costs of the Project.  The Loan shall be evidenced and secured by the Note, the Security Documents and other Loan Documents, as applicable.  Those instruments shall be executed and delivered by the Borrower to the Lender on the Closing Date, concurrently with the execution and delivery of this Loan Agreement and the delivery of all other documents and the satisfaction of all other closing conditions required by the Commitment.  The Loan shall be disbursed on or about the Disbursement Date pursuant to Section 3.6 hereof, upon the satisfaction of the conditions set forth in Section 3.5 hereof.  The Loan shall be disbursed only from and only to the extent that on the Disbursement Date funds not heretofore committed are available to make the Loan from moneys in the Escrow Account.  The terms of repayment of the Loan shall be as set forth in the Note, and the Borrower shall make all payments required to be made under the Note as and when due.

Section 3.2.    The Project.  The Borrower (a)  has commenced or shall promptly hereafter commence the Project;  (b) shall pay or cause to be paid all expenses incurred in connection with the Project from funds made available therefor in accordance with this Loan Agreement or otherwise; and (c ) shall demand, sue for, levy and recover all sums of money and debts which may be due and payable under the terms of any contract, order, receipt, guaranty, warranty, writing or instruction in connection with the Project and will enforce the terms of any contract, agreement, obligation, bond or other performance security  with respect thereto.  The Borrower covenants and confirms its agreement in the Commitment that, to the extent that the Project involves construction, all wages paid to laborers and mechanics employed on the Project shall be paid at not less than the prevailing rates of wages for laborers and mechanics for the class of work called for by the Project, which wages shall be determined in accordance with the requirements of Sections 4115.03 through 4115.16, Ohio Revised Code, for determination of prevailing wage rates, subject, however, to the exceptions set forth in Section 166.02(E) of the Act.

 
8

 
 
Ohio 166 - Loan Agreement
Exhibit 10.58
10/5/2011
 
 
Section 3.3.    Inspections.   At its option, the Lender may retain, at the Borrower’s expense, an architect, engineer, appraiser or other consultant for the purpose of verifying costs and performing inspections of the Project.  Such inspections shall impose no responsibility or liability of any nature upon the Lender, the Director, the State of Ohio, their respective agents, representatives or designees nor, without limitation, carry any warranty or representation as to the adequacy or safety of the structures or any of their component parts or any other physical condition or feature pertaining to the Project.

Section 3.4.   Insufficiency of Proceeds.   In the event that the Loan is not sufficient to pay all costs of the Project, the Borrower shall, nonetheless and irrespective of the cause of such deficiency, pay all costs of the Project in full from its own funds.

Section 3.5.   Conditions to Disbursement   The Loan shall be disbursed in accordance with Section 3.6 of this Loan Agreement, provided the Lender shall have received the instruments, certifications, documents and opinions described in Exhibit F attached hereto and made a part hereof, each in form and substance satisfactory to the Lender.

Section 3.6.    Disbursement of Loan.    The Loan shall be disbursed in accordance with the terms of the Escrow Agreement in the amount of the Loan Amount, as determined by the Lender in his sole discretion based on the Cost Certification, to or at the direction of the Borrower on or about the Disbursement Date upon satisfaction of the conditions specified in Section 3.5 hereof and confirmation that the Security Documents and all other documents or instruments required to create and perfect the liens and security interests intended to be created by the Security Documents at the level of priority therein provided have been filed for record in such places and in such manner as to create and perfect fully and completely such liens and security interests.  If for any reason the Loan shall not have been disbursed on the Disbursement Date, this Loan Agreement shall automatically terminate and, subject to the provisions of Sections 3.7  and 3.8  hereof, be of no further force and effect.  For purposes of this Section, time is of the essence.

Section 3.7.   Payment of Costs.    The Borrower shall pay all costs incident to the Loan, including but not limited to recording and title fees, title examination and insurance fees, UCC search and filing fees, and legal fees.

Section 3.8.   Indemnification.   The Borrower shall defend, indemnify and hold the Lender and the Director and any officials of the Lender and the State of Ohio harmless against any and all losses, costs, expenses, claims or actions arising out of or connected with the execution and delivery of this Loan Agreement or any other Loan Documents and the preparation of documents relating to the disbursement of the Loan, including, but not limited to, all aforementioned costs and expenses and the costs and expenses, including attorneys’ fees, of any action brought pursuant to Chapter 4115, Ohio Revised Code, regardless of whether or not the disbursement of the Loan shall actually occur.  Without detracting from the generality of the foregoing, the Borrower expressly agrees to defend, indemnify and hold harmless the Lender and the Director from and against any and all claims, demands, judgments, damages, actions, causes of action, injuries, administrative orders, consent agreements and orders, liabilities, penalties, costs and expenses of any kind whatsoever, including claims arising out of loss of life, injury to persons, property, or business or damage to natural resources in connection with the activities of the Borrower, its predecessors in interest, third parties who have trespassed on the Project, or parties in a contractual relationship with the Borrower, or any of them, whether or not occasioned wholly or in part by any condition, accident or event caused by any act or omission of the Lender, the Director, the Borrower, previous owners of the Project Site or any of their officers, agents, employees, successors, assigns or guarantors, which:

 (h)
Job Creation and Preservation.     Create and preserve not fewer than ninety percent (90%) of the new jobs and employment opportunities, and preserve not fewer than the existing jobs and employment opportunities, each as represented by the Borrower in the Application and this Loan Agreement, within the three (3)-year period immediately following the Closing Date.

 
(i)
Minority Employment.     Except as may be occasioned by Adverse Market Conditions, achieve not less than ninety percent (90%) of the Minority Employment Requirement on the Project within the three (3)-year period immediately following the Closing Date.

 
(j)
Buy-Ohio Requirement.     Utilize its best efforts to purchase goods and services from Ohio-based companies.

ARTICLE V

EVENTS OF DEFAULT AND REMEDIES

Section 5.1.     Events of Default.     Each of the following shall be an event of default under this Loan Agreement:

 
(a)
The Borrower shall fail to pay, or cause to be paid, any amount payable pursuant to this Loan Agreement or under the Note within ten (10) days immediately following the date on which such payment is due and payable; or
 
(b)
The Borrower or any of the Guarantors shall, as applicable:
 
(i)
die or become insolvent;
 
(ii)
admit in writing its inability to pay its debts generally as they become due;
 
(iii)
have an order for relief entered in any case commenced by or against it under the federal bankruptcy laws, as now or hereafter in effect;
 
(iv)
commence a proceeding under any other federal or state bankruptcy, insolvency, reorganization or other similar law, or have such a proceeding commenced against it and either have an order of insolvency or reorganization entered against it or have the proceeding remain undismissed and unstayed for a period of ninety (90) days;
 
(v)
make an assignment for the benefit of creditors; or,
 
(vi)
have a receiver, trustee or custodian appointed for it or for the whole or any substantial part of its property; or

 
(c) 
The Borrower shall fail to observe and perform any agreement, term, covenant or condition contained in this Loan Agreement, other than asrequired pursuant to subsections (a) and (b) of this Section 5.1, and such failure shall continue for a period of thirty (30) days after notice of such failure is given to the Borrower by the Lender, or for such longer period as the Lender may agree to in writing; provided, that if the failure is of such nature that it can be corrected but not within the applicable period, such failure shall not constitute an Event of Default so long as the Borrower institutes curative action within the applicable period and diligently pursues such action to completion; or

 
(d)
Any representation or warranty made by the Borrower or the Guarantors or any of their respective partners, agents, directors or officers, as the case may be, herein or in the Application, the Commitments, any other of the Loan Documents, or in connection herewith or therewith shall prove to have been incorrect in any material respect when made; or

 
(e)
The Borrower shall fail to pay any indebtedness of the Borrower, or any interest or premium thereon, when due (whether by scheduled maturity, required prepayment, by acceleration, on demand or otherwise) and such failure shall continue after the applicable grace period, if any, specified in the agreement or instrument relating to any such indebtedness, or any other event, shall occur and shall continue after the applicable grace period, if any, specified in such agreement or instrument, if the effect of such default or event is to accelerate, or to permit the acceleration of, the maturity of such indebtedness or any such indebtedness shall be declared to be due and payable, or required to be prepaid (other than by a regularly scheduled required prepayment), prior to the stated maturity thereof; or
